Jason Young is a 29 year old professional poker player who caught his life changing break at the 2008 WSOP where he won Event #17 a $1500 Shootout for 335k and his first WSOP Bracelet. Young left his job with the Parks and Recreation Department 6 months earlier where he was earning 35k a year. Jason is a member of PPI Elite (pokerplayersinternational.com) In his 3 year career he has amassed over 725k in Live tournament earnings. Follow him on Twitter @jyoungpoker.
